连环画 --- 三国演义(41-61)
本帖最后由 也曾年轻 于 2025-12-17 14:45 编辑 <br /><br /><meta charset="utf-8"><meta name="referrer" content="never" />
<style type="text/css">
:root {--w:800px; --h:600px;}
#oBlk {
width:940px;height:960px;
background-image: url(https://z3.ax1x.com/2021/09/16/4nMjJA.gif);
display: grid;
place-items:center;position:relative;
grid-template-rows: 770px 170px;
grid-template-columns:100%;
box-shadow:3px 3px 8px darkgray;
overflow:hidden;border-radius:24px;
font-size:12px;padding:10px;
margin:80px auto 40px calc(50% - 551px);
}
#cataFrame {width:880px;height:170px;border:6px white groove;overflow:hidden;border-radius:24px;position:relative;}
/***************************************************************************************************/
#imgHold img {width:var(--w);height:var(--h); position:absolute;top:0px;}
#imgHold {height:var(--h);position:absolute;left:0px;}
#storyBookBlk {
width:var(--w);
height:var(--h);
overflow:hidden;
border-radius:24px;
box-shadow:4px 4px 10px black;
position:relative;
}
#targetD {width:880px;height:720px;border:6px white groove;place-items:center;overflow:hidden;border-radius:24px;}
#gName {font:bold 2.5em 隶书;color:brown;margin:12px;}
#pichold {height:160px;position:absolute;left:0px;top:0px;margin-top:5px;animation: mleft 42.8s linear infinite paused;}
#pichold img {width:200px;height:160px;margin-right:4px;cursor:pointer;float:left;}
#pichold:hover {animation-play-state: running;}
@keyframes mleft {to {left:-4284px;}}
</style>
<div id="oBlk">
<div id="targetD">
<div id="gName">《连城》</div>
<div id="storyBookBlk">
<div id="imgHold">
<!--
-->
</div>
</div>
</div>
<div id="cataFrame"><div id="pichold"></div></div>
</div>
<script>
let hVal = parseInt(getComputedStyle(document.documentElement).getPropertyValue('--w'));
var sf1 = document.createElement('script');
sf1.type = 'text/javascript';
sf1.src = "https://cccimg.com/down.php/fe305a3cc40cb8053f988cc23f8fc2fb.js";
//sf1.src = "./三国演义(下)pic.js";
sf1.charset = "utf-8";
document.body.appendChild(sf1);
sf1.onload = () => {
gName.innerHTML = gsName;
imgs.forEach((pic,idx) => {
let imgObj = document.createElement('img');
imgObj.src = pic; imgObj.alt = '';
imgObj.dataset.idx = idx % gsName.length;
pichold.appendChild(imgObj);
});
let imgObj = pichold.querySelector('img');
let imgObjWidth = imgObj.clientWidth + parseInt(getComputedStyle(imgObj).marginLeft) + parseInt(getComputedStyle(imgObj).marginRight);
pichold.style.width = imgs.length *imgObjWidth + 'px';
// 点击封面图片的动作
pichold.querySelectorAll('img').forEach( imgObj => {
imgObj.onclick = () => {
let selIdx = imgObj.dataset.idx;
gName.innerHTML = gsName;
loadStory(selIdx);
}
});
let loadStory = (idx) => {
imgHold.innerHTML = '';
imgHold.style.left = '0px';
imgHold.style.width = pics.length * hVal + 'px';;
pics.forEach((pic, idx) => {
let imgObj = document.createElement('img');
imgObj.src = pic;pic.alt='';
imgObj.style.left = hVal * idx + 'px';
imgHold.appendChild(imgObj);
});
let numPic = imgHold.querySelectorAll('img');
imgHold.onmousedown = (ev) => {
let styleLeft = parseInt(imgHold.style.left);
let sbOffsetWidth = parseInt(storyBookBlk.offsetWidth);
let imgOffsetLeft = parseInt(imgHold.offsetLeft);
if(ev.button === 0) {
if(styleLeft > ((1 - numPic.length) * sbOffsetWidth)) imgHold.style.left = (imgOffsetLeft -= sbOffsetWidth) + 'px';
else imgHold.style.left = '0px';
}
else if(ev.button === 2) {
if(imgOffsetLeft === 0)imgHold.style.left = (1 - numPic.length) * sbOffsetWidth + 'px';
else imgHold.style.left = (imgOffsetLeft += sbOffsetWidth) + 'px';
}
}
oBlk.addEventListener('contextmenu', function(event) {
event.preventDefault();
});
}
loadStory(0);
}
</script>
三国演义(1-20)
三国演义(21-40)
欣赏老师的巨作《三国演义(41-61)》,辛苦了!{:4_187:} 闲时可以看小书来了。有地方去了哈。{:4_189:} 梦江南 发表于 2025-12-17 15:07
欣赏老师的巨作《三国演义(41-61)》,辛苦了!
谢谢欣赏支持 梦江南 发表于 2025-12-17 15:10
闲时可以看小书来了。有地方去了哈。
到处看看消磨时光{:5_106:} 也曾年轻 发表于 2025-12-17 15:26
到处看看消磨时光
你厉害哦,这么大部巨作也能轻松搞定 梦江南 发表于 2025-12-17 15:36
你厉害哦,这么大部巨作也能轻松搞定
比做音画帖要简单,就是复制粘贴。 也曾年轻 发表于 2025-12-17 16:01
比做音画帖要简单,就是复制粘贴。
这么多东西要复制到啥时候哦,眼睛也看花了。 梦江南 发表于 2025-12-17 17:20
这么多东西要复制到啥时候哦,眼睛也看花了。
嗯,是有点。不过是成批的操作,勉强能够承受{:5_102:} 也曾年轻 发表于 2025-12-17 18:00
嗯,是有点。不过是成批的操作,勉强能够承受
也只有你才会做这种大部头作品。做完了吗? 年度钜献,谢谢也曾年轻老师经典分享{:4_180:} 梦江南 发表于 2025-12-17 18:13
也只有你才会做这种大部头作品。做完了吗?
三国这个版本的做完了 杨帆 发表于 2025-12-17 18:46
年度钜献,谢谢也曾年轻老师经典分享
谢谢欣赏支持!
晚上好! 感谢也曾年轻老师,又是这么多三国的小人书,看看那时候的故事真好{:4_187:} 红影 发表于 2025-12-17 20:00
感谢也曾年轻老师,又是这么多三国的小人书,看看那时候的故事真好
做成帖子也算是个练习, 哇塞,又一个浩大的工程,佩服高手老师的好制作,这个我又要收藏了,{:4_205:} 小辣椒 发表于 2025-12-17 22:00
哇塞,又一个浩大的工程,佩服高手老师的好制作,这个我又要收藏了,
谢谢支持!
页:
[1]